The Spanish heist crime drama, originally titled "La Casa de Papel," burst onto the scene, quickly achieving cult status and drawing viewers into its meticulously crafted world. The series, featuring a stellar cast including rsula Corber, lvaro Morte, Itziar Ituo, and Pedro Alonso, captivated audiences with its high-stakes narrative and complex characters.
The Professor, the enigmatic mastermind behind the elaborate heists, carefully recruits a team of skilled individuals, each possessing unique expertise and a shared characteristic: they have nothing to lose. This ragtag group, brought together for their individual skills and desperation, embarks on audacious plans that challenge the boundaries of law and morality. From the Royal Mint of Spain to the Bank of Spain, the heists are meticulously planned and executed, keeping viewers on the edge of their seats.

The series also explores broader themes of social inequality, resistance against the establishment, and the complexities of human relationships. These themes resonate with viewers and add a layer of depth to the entertainment value, encouraging reflection and discussion.
The impact of the series on popular culture is undeniable. Phrases from the show, like "Bella Ciao," have become anthems of resistance and unity. The characters' iconic costumes and masks have become symbols of rebellion and solidarity, appearing at protests and demonstrations around the world. Feature | Details |
---|---|
Title | Money Heist (La Casa de Papel) |
Genre | Heist Crime Drama |
Original Language | Spanish |
Creators | lex Pina |
Main Cast | rsula Corber, lvaro Morte, Itziar Ituo, Pedro Alonso, etc. |
Number of Seasons | 5 |
Release Date (Season 1) | May 2, 2017 (Spain) |
Network (Original) | Antena 3 (Spain) |
Netflix | Global Distribution |
Plot Summary | A criminal mastermind known as "The Professor" recruits a group of eight thieves to carry out a series of heists, targeting the Royal Mint of Spain and later the Bank of Spain. |
Themes | Resistance, Revolution, Family, Love, Loyalty, Betrayal, Social Inequality, Political Commentary |
Notable Features | Intricate Plot Twists, Strong Character Development, High-Stakes Action, Use of Flashbacks, Intense Suspense |
Cultural Impact | "Bella Ciao" as an Anthem, Dal Masks as a Symbol of Resistance, Global Fanbase |
Spinoff | Berlin |
